What you'll pay — and where
The lowest day rate in the current inventory is $276 at HQ MA, Cambridge - Phillips Place (West Cambridge), a 6-person room. In Kendall Square, Regus MA, Cambridge - Kendall Square lists MR-1807 at $478/day for 4 people and MR-1827 at $628/day for 6. Harvard Square sits at the top end, with the Boardroom at $649/day for 8 attendees. Pricing broadly follows real-estate density — West Cambridge runs cheaper than the more established Kendall Square or Harvard Square addresses.

Room sizes available
The inventory breaks down into four capacity tiers: small rooms for 1–4 people (32 spaces), medium rooms for 5–10 people (43 spaces), larger training-style rooms for 11–20 people (32 spaces), and event or conference setups for 21 and above (32 spaces). The 5–10 person tier has the deepest selection with 43 available spaces — useful if your team size sits in that range and you want the most options to compare.

Key locations and transit access
Kendall Square is the most transit-accessible cluster in the inventory. Regus MA, Cambridge - Kendall Square sits 558 meters from Kendall/MIT subway station on the Red Line. Venues in West Cambridge and Harvard Square are closer to Alewife transit station — HQ MA, Cambridge - Phillips Place is 2,605 meters away, and Regus MA, Cambridge - Harvard Square-Mifflin Place is 2,950 meters out. For attendees arriving by commuter rail, Regus MA, Cambridge - Kendall Square is also the closest to South Station at 2,327 meters.
What's included and how booking works
Meeting rooms across the inventory include Wi-Fi, a screen or TV, a paperboard, and still water as standard. About 80% of venues have on-site reception. Catering — breakfast, lunch, coffee and tea service, or a sweet break — can be ordered from most venues with at least 48 hours' notice. Printing is available at an additional per-copy charge, and parking is an optional add-on at select locations.
Bookings are confirmed instantly by email, with an invoice generated at the time of payment. Accepted payment methods include credit and debit cards, PayPal, Apple Pay, Google Pay, and Klarna. Cancellation terms are shown on the booking screen before payment is taken, and refunds are processed automatically when a cancellation qualifies. Same-day booking is available subject to slot availability — no fixed cutoff applies.
